    Default Trouble with autopilot

    I have a autopilot model DIG-220.Last year at the end of the season the digital screen would go off when ever you tryed to check any of the readings or shut the pump off. If i shut it off and turned it back on the screen would come back on. When I started the pool about 4 weeks ago it was working fine but with in the last few days it went out and won't come back on at all.I did check the wire harness inside they seem to be all pluugged in . Any help with this problem would be appreciated thanks, Bill

    Default Re: Trouble with autopilot

    Bill, I'm not sure as to why this is happening. I have not seen it before. I would only guess to check the incoming line wires when the display goes blank. That would mean remove the inner metal cover so you can test it without powering it down to take it off later.
    I would suspect too, that the top display board (#833N) may be damaged.
    KEEP IN MIND that there is a "Screen Saver" mode so that if no buttons are pressed within a 10 minute period, the display will go to a walking dot.... just a dot that moves along the top row of pixels then the bottom row, and back to the top. This goes on until any button is pressed.

    If the buttons are not responding at all, you may want to take the top cover off and inspect the plastic stand off posts that the board is screwed down to. If they are split of broken off, it may be allowing the board to push away whenever you try pressing a button.
